Focal colors and unique hues

Summary
This study found that focal colors and unique hues for red, green, blue, and yellow are very similar. Young adults identified nearly identical color patches for these basic color terms across different saturation levels.

Background:
- Understanding basic color terms is crucial for cross-cultural communication and cognitive science.
- Previous research suggests universal tendencies in color naming, but the relationship between focal colors and unique hues requires further empirical validation.
Purpose of the Study:
- To empirically investigate the relationship between focal colors and unique hues for primary color terms (red, green, blue, yellow).
- To determine if saturation levels influence the identification of focal and unique colors.
Main Methods:
- Recruited 40 young adults to participate in the study.
- Participants selected focal colors and unique hues from 100 color patches presented on white paper.
- Color saturation was systematically varied across four distinct levels.
Main Results:
- The mean focal colors and mean unique hues for red, green, blue, and yellow were found to be almost identical.
- This consistency was observed across the different saturation levels tested.
Conclusions:
- Focal colors and unique hues represent a highly consistent perceptual and cognitive phenomenon for basic color terms.
- The findings support the existence of universal, language-independent representations for fundamental colors in human vision.
